Why Educational Credential Assessment (ECA) Matters

Before we dive into the details, let's first understand why ECA is essential. Most countries want to ensure that your qualifications are equivalent to their education standards. An ECA is often a mandatory requirement for study permits, skilled migration visas, and professional recognition. It can open doors to numerous opportunities but can also seem like a maze of paperwork and regulations.

Step 1: Identify Your Needs

The first step in the ECA process is understanding your specific requirements. Are you a student seeking to enroll in a master's program, or a professional looking to prove your expertise? Different purposes may require different types of assessments. Research is key here. Each country may have its preferred assessment organizations, like WES in Canada or NACES in the USA.

Key Considerations:

  • Verify which organizations are recognized by the immigration authorities of your target country.
  • Determine if there are any occupation-specific assessments that apply to you.

Step 2: Select the Right Assessing Organization

Choosing the right assessing body is critical as each has its own fees, processing times, and document requirements. Begin by visiting the website of the assessment organization you decide to use, where you’ll find detailed instructions on their specific processes.

Questions to Ask:

  • What are the processing times for each organization?
  • Are there specific documents or translations required?

Step 3: Gather Your Documents

Once you’ve selected an organization, the rigorous task of document preparation begins. Typically, you’ll need to provide:

  • Transcripts of records from your educational institution.
  • Degree certificates.
  • Translations of any document not in the official language required by the assessing body.

Step 4: Submit Your Application

When you have everything ready, it’s time to submit your application. Double-check all the information you provide, as errors can delay the process. Most assessing bodies will allow you to track your application online, giving you peace of mind as you await confirmation.

Step 5: Understanding Your ECA Report

Finally, you'll receive your ECA report. This document will indicate the equivalency of your foreign credentials within the host country's education framework. It’s crucial to understand this report completely, as it will be required for visa applications, job applications, or university enrollments.

Common Issues:

  • Discrepancies: Occasionally, the ECA may not equate your degree to an equivalent local degree.
  • Expiration: ECAs may have expiration dates or conditions linked to specific visa or application processes.
